(Senior) Postdoctoral Research Scientist – Biological Foundation Models


Applications are invited for a Postdoctoral Research Scientist or Senior Postdoctoral Research Scientist to join Professor Ke Li's AI for Biology Group in the Research Faculty of the Earlham Institute, based in Norwich, UK.


Background

The AI for Biology Group will be newly established at the Earlham Institute (EI), while building on Professor Ke Li’s established and well-funded research programme in fundamental AI, AI co-scientists, and applications in complex scientific domains such as RNA sequence-function modelling, structure prediction, and inverse design.


The role

We are seeking an ambitious researcher to develop foundation models for biological discovery within a new AI for Biology Group at EI. The successful candidate will create novel AI methods for the pretraining, post-training, adaptation and evaluation of foundation models that support hypothesis generation and experimentally grounded biological discovery.


Building on Professor Ke Li's established research programme in AI for science, the role focuses on developing new AI systems rather than simply applying existing machine learning approaches to biological datasets. The post offers extensive collaboration across the Institute, supporting the development of multimodal biological foundation models, AI-guided design-build-test-learn workflows, and open algorithms, benchmarks and reproducible research.


Ideal candidate

The successful candidate will have a PhD (awarded or expected within 6 months) in Computer Science, AI, Machine Learning, Computational Biology, Mathematics, Statistics, Physics, Electrical Engineering, or a related quantitative discipline.


They will have excellent programming skills in Python and practical experience with modern deep learning frameworks such as PyTorch, JAX or TensorFlow, alongside experience with large-scale model training, GPU/HPC/cloud computing environments, Linux, version control and reproducible research workflows. Experience with large-scale AI training ecosystems, including Hugging Face, DeepSpeed, FSDP, Megatron-LM, Ray or equivalent tools, would be advantageous.


Candidates should demonstrate experience developing, adapting or evaluating original AI algorithms rather than solely applying existing methods. Evidence of high-quality research outputs commensurate with career stage, including publications in leading venues in AI and machine learning, computational biology or AI for science, is essential. Experience with foundation-model pre-training in natural language processing, computer vision or biological domains, including genomics, transcriptomics, proteins, DNA or RNA, would be highly beneficial.


Additional information

  • Salary on appointment will be within the range £39,000 to £46,500 per annum depending on qualifications and experience for the SC6 level post, and £47,450 to £52,560 per annum for candidates who meet the SC5 level criteria.
  • This is a full-time post for a contract of 36 months, with possible extension.
  • This role meets the criteria for a visa application, and we encourage all qualified candidates to apply. Please contact the Human Resources Team if you have any questions regarding your application or visa options.
  • As a Disability Confident employer, we guarantee to offer an interview to all disabled applicants who meet the essential criteria for this vacancy.
  • The closing date for applications will be 18 September 2026.
